TreZix raises $1.2M to streamline and digitize export, import process

Mumbai-based TreZix has secured $1.2 million in seed stage funding from a combination of investors, including the Government of Gujarat startup grant and Soha Ventures.

The company aims to streamline and digitize the export and import process, offering features for logistics, financial management, and compliance.

TreZix is a unified SaaS platform for importers and exporters globally, providing comprehensive management of documentation, approvals, license usage, shipment tracking, and active notifications of businesses for seamless operations.

The platform also offers access to a smart dashboard to its clients with real-time data on critical business metrics necessary for effective decision-making.

The platform seeks to be the go-to for businesses to increase their efficiency and bottom line in India, which is predicted to become a $3 trillion export-import market.

Founded by Sunil Kharbanda, Haresh Calcuttawala, and Shailesh Sapale, TreZix began its journey in 2020 when it presented the platform’s framework to the Government of Gujarat. The state government then offered them a grant and helped them with customer acquisition through chambers. TreZix was officially incorporated in January 2022 and commercially launched in October of the same year.

Sunil Kharbanda, co-founder and Chief Revenue Officer at TreZix, said the company aims to offer an end-to-end digital platform for importers and exporters to bring ease and rapid growth to their businesses. TreZix has already acquired initial customers, and the feedback has been positive, with the company reducing the cost and time taken to handle the export and import processes.
